Output 186436126dcbaee3a2c662a167b3f1695c28f70c2d501dc076dfbf9e5ef47717:1

value
1093702
script pubkey
OP_0 OP_PUSHBYTES_20 c00e20843974f3236b69da136906b706254f454e
address
ltc1qcq8zpppewnejx6mfmgfkjp4hqcj5732whdxvdw
transaction
186436126dcbaee3a2c662a167b3f1695c28f70c2d501dc076dfbf9e5ef47717
spent
true